Cromwell Court Care Home is located just a short distance from the pleasant town of Warrington and can be easily reached by public transport.

The home can accommodate both married couples and single residents and every effort is made to make residents and their families at home. The emphasis at Cromwell Court Care Home is on creating a friendly relaxed environment whilst providing the best care possible.

Cromwell Court Care Home has a dedicated Activities Co-ordinator who ensures that residents are kept occupied with a packed calendar of events, outings and occasions. The team at Cromwell Court Care Home also endeavour to mark every birthday, anniversary and special occasion with a celebration. Cromwell Court Care Home's team also get involved in a number of fundraising activities and are always ready to get dressed up.

Funding & Fees

Weekly Charges per Person

  • Self-Funded Residential Dementia Care: from £1100
  • Self-Funded Nursing Dementia Care: from £1300
  • RESPITE Self-Funded Residential Dementia Care: from £1300
  • RESPITE Self-Funded Nursing Dementia Care: from £1300

Residential care and nursing care are not normally accommodated.
Final fees are subject to assessment of the potential resident, the size of the room offered and the facilities needed / available.
Additional services such as hairdressing, chiropody, newspapers and excursions are not included in the standard weekly fees.

These prices are only a guideline, please contact Cromwell Court Care Home to find out the exact price for your requirements.

Support you may be entitled to

If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£254.06 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  • a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.

    The Average Rating of 4.708 for Cromwell Court Care Home is calculated as follows: ( (291 Excellents x 5) + (45 Goods x 4) + (15 Satisfactorys x 3) + (2 Poors x 2) + (6 Very Poors x 1) ) ÷ 359 Ratings = 4.708

  • b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Cromwell Court Care Home is based on 28 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    • i) 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4

    • ii) 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 67 registered maximum number of service users is 13.4, which has been reached with 28 Positive reviews. Points = 1

  • When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.

  • If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
